Course Description

ACCT 314H: Advanced Accounting (Honors)

3 credits
 

This is a capstone course and that provides the student with an understanding of some of the more complex topics in accounting. The class will cover several general topical areas, including: accounting for business acquisitions and combinations, the preparation of consolidated financial statements, accounting for state and local governmental units. Additional potential topics include partnership accounting and foreign currency transactions and translations.  

 
Prerequisites: ACCT 311/311H and ACCT 312/312H
